Demo

Senior Embedded Software Engineer

Belcan
Irvine, CA Full Time
POSTED ON 4/3/2025
AVAILABLE BEFORE 5/4/2025

Job Title: Senior Embedded Software Engineer

Pay Rate: $112K - $188k /yr (and an annual bonus!)

Location: Irvine, CA (Hybrid)

Zip Code: 92612

Start Date: Right Away

Job Type: Direct Hire

Schedule: M-F

Keywords: #EmbeddedSoftwareEngineer #SeniorEmbeddedSoftwareEngineer



JOB RESPONSIBILITIES:

* Design, implement, integrate and verify software applications and tools using C\C under Linux.

* Enhance, optimize and improve efficiency and robustness of the current software.

* Participate in requirements analysis, architecture and design processes

* Collaborate with multiple development teams

* Review, evaluate and analyze test plans and procedures

* Support system test programs, analyze results and improve overall system quality

* Lead and provide technical guidance to engineers, designers and support personnel

* Participate in a complete software development lifecycle using Agile methodologies.

* Oversee and manage deployed system performance and in-service performance with intent of recommending and guiding solutions to satisfy our customers.

* Participate in development and leadership of appropriate architecture solutions and enhancements for planned system deployments and improvements.

* Participate in the full SDLC ( Software Development Life Cycle ) system from requirements gathering to Production deployment to supporting production.


REQUIRED QUALIFICATIONS:

* Bachelor of Science Degree in Computer Sciences, Computer Engineering or Software Engineering, or equivalent experience required.

* 8 years of embedded software development experience.

* Knowledge of C required

* Experience in real time multi-threaded software.

* Experience in development under Linux.

* Familiarity with satellite networks, antenna systems and related communication protocols is desirable.


Preferred Skills:

* Knowledge of C (14/17 and later)

* Socket Programming, IPC, and PUB/SUB architecture (Kafka/MQTT)

* Strong understanding of Networking Protocols (TCP/UDP/IP/HTTP/SNMP/DHCP/DNS and familiarity with VLANs and basic switching and routing concepts.

* Agile/Scrum

*CI/CD


Our overriding goal is to provide quality staffing solutions that help people, organizations, and communities succeed. Belcan is a leading provider of qualified personnel to many of the world's most respected enterprises. We offer excellent opportunities for contract, temporary, temp-to-hire, and direct assignments. We are the employer of choice for thousands worldwide. For more information, please visit our website at Belcan.com

EOE/F/M/Disability/Veterans

Salary : $112,000 - $188,000

If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

What is the career path for a Senior Embedded Software Engineer?

Sign up to receive alerts about other jobs on the Senior Embedded Software Engineer career path by checking the boxes next to the positions that interest you.
Income Estimation: 
$117,524 - $131,245
Income Estimation: 
$145,630 - $167,634
Income Estimation: 
$117,524 - $131,245
Income Estimation: 
$145,630 - $167,634
Income Estimation: 
$173,217 - $199,061
Income Estimation: 
$210,444 - $312,772
Income Estimation: 
$90,609 - $105,383
Income Estimation: 
$117,524 - $131,245
Income Estimation: 
$145,630 - $167,634
Income Estimation: 
$162,729 - $194,659
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Belcan

Belcan
Hired Organization Address Cincinnati, OH Full Time
Details : A Power Systems Software & Controls Engineer (Senior Grid Scale Energy Engineer) job is currently available th...
Belcan
Hired Organization Address Los Angeles, CA Full Time
PC Support Specialist Job Number : 351949 Category : Help Desk / Support Description : Job Title : PC Support Specialist...
Belcan
Hired Organization Address Sunnyvale, CA Temporary
Job Title : Talent Acquisition Business Partner 3 Location : Sunnyvale, CA (Remote) Duration : 06 Months Contract (Poten...
Belcan
Hired Organization Address Valley, AZ Full Time
Job Title: Shipping & Receiving Supervisor Location: ​ Oro Valley, AZ Duration: Direct Hire Payrate: $75K – 85K Annually...

Not the job you're looking for? Here are some other Senior Embedded Software Engineer jobs in the Irvine, CA area that may be a better fit.

Senior Embedded Software Engineer

Randstad Digital, Irvine, CA

Senior Embedded Software Engineer

TP-Link Systems Inc., Irvine, CA

AI Assistant is available now!

Feel free to start your new journey!